With the rapid development of WIMAX, the3GPP proposes long-term evolution (LTE) project. Compared with the traditional communication services, LTE has many advantages,such as improving data transfer rate and spectrum efficiency,increasing the system capacity, enhancing the ability of anti-interference, reducing commercial cost and so on, and has much breakthrough.So it is very valuable to study. There are many key technologies,which are OFDM,multiple antennas and channel coding in downlink.These advanced technologies greatly improve the performance of the transmitter, realize treliable and stable transmission of the system, and the receiver can more accurately restored the data which is passed random and complex space channelIn LTE downlink, there are OFDM technology, in order to obtain high frequency spectrum efficiency, this system needs to adopt multilevel and constant amplitude modulation mode (such as16QAM) by coherent demodulation.And coherent demodulation need to estimate and track the parameters of the fading channel. So it is very important for OFDM system to obtain the accurate parameters of channel.Therefore, in order to get as accurate as possible parameters of the channel at the receiver, it is necessary to study all kinds of channel estimation technology. Based on the LS channel estimation algorithm and DFT channel estimation algorithm, which is studied and analysed, this paper proposes the improved algorithm of DFT channel estimation algorithm, and then simulate the three channel estimation algorithm. The result of simulation indicates that the improved algorithm can obtain more accurate channel information.According to the3GPP physical layer related protocol and actual project,this paper designs LTE downlink with downlink Shared channel, this paper studies and designs transmitter scheme, which is including channel coding and the process of symbols. According to the TS36physical series agreement about FDD mode, and referring to the standard agreement, there set up a complete downlink Shared channel and realize the FDD receiver system, which is including channel decoding and the process of symbols. In this paper, there is to study resources mapping module,which is the mapping of the distributed virtual resource blocks to physical resource blocks.In protocol, there are formulas for this mapping,but the process is very complex and the result is unordered, for completing the mapping, it must sort the result,so greatly adding the time of the hardware realization.Then this paper studies the calculation method and puts forward to a more simple calculation method, so as to save the time of FPGA or DSP realization. Finally, for the technical difficulties in LTE downlink, based on this paper, there are the key points for further studies.
